The Guardian Media Group's Manchester television station, Channel M, has been awarded a licence to broadcast on Freeview.

The station, which already broadcasts on satellite, could be available to as many as 500,000 households across Greater Manchester once the Granada region switches off its analogue transmitters and goes digital this November.

The digital television switchover, which will be completed in 2012, has freed up regional space previously used to stop transmitters interfering with each other. Ofcom will award its next licence in the Cardiff area later this month.
